Also here: https://git.kernel.org/pub/scm/linux/kernel/git/dhowells/linux-fs.git/log/= ?h=3Diov-cifs-mm David --- commit 71ad4f67439e60fe04bbf7aed8870e6f83a5d15e Author: David Howells Date: Tue Feb 21 13:23:05 2023 +0000 cifs: Handle transition to filemap_get_folios_tag() = filemap_get_folios_tag() is being added and find_get_pages_range_tag()= is being removed in effectively a single event. This causes a problem fo= r the: = cifs: Change the I/O paths to use an iterator rather than a page l= ist = patch[1] on the cifs/for-next branch as it's adding a new user of the latter (which is going away), but can't yet be converted to using the former (which doesn't yet exist upstream). = Here's a conversion patch that could be applied at merge time to deal = with this.
